    I just did some digging and I hope this will help out you all putting 4runner seats in your tacomas. Apparently the 96-98 base model 4runner seats use completely different mounts. You can verify this by looking at the feet. The ones you need should have the sideways mount to attach to the transmission tunnel and the inside rear. I believe the 96-98 base model seats are the "lesser" quality ones anyway, and don't provide any side bolster support.
